SUMMARY:Third Thursday September 18: Join us! 5-8 p.m.
DESCRIPTION:Concord Center welcomes you for art\, culture\, shopping\, and dining from 5:00 PM to 8:00 PM\, featuring over 30 local businesses staying open late with special offerings. \nThe September 18th event includes live music and interactive entertainment for all ages. Gail Carey Trio brings jazz piano and vocals to the lawn of the Visitors center.On the lawn of the Middlesex Bank make a kite to take home.  \nPick up a “Third Thursday Passport” at the Visitors Center or any participating business.  Collect a stamp or signature from any four Concord businesses to be entered to win a gift basket.  There’s a new gift basket available every month! \nVisitors can expect extended business hours at shops\, galleries\, and eateries\, alongside sidewalk games\, chalk art\, and hands-on arts activities. Participating businesses will also offer unique in-store experiences\, making Third Thursday a highlight of your calendar in Concord. \nThird Thursday in Concord Center is executed by the Town of Concord in partnership with the Concord Chamber of Commerce.   Programming is supported by the Concord Cultural Council and the Mass Cultural Council as part of the Concord Center Cultural District program\, celebrating local arts and community spirit.
